What a Day!!
First we took a ferry to THE ROCK - Alcatraz Island. We wandered around the Island and watched a short Discovery film about the Island - was actually really interesting to know all the different things that the Island has been used for - Military, Prison, Indian Occupation, National Park
We did an audio tour within the cell block - this was GREAT - it told you so much while giving you a walking tour - and it was told by actual officers and prisoners who had been then. The place was incredible - I would not like to have been there - the cells were so small, and you can hear and see San Fran so easily that it would have been horrible knowing everything was so close. Neat fun learning about the escape attempts as well - not many succeeded - well acutally only three people were never found so they don't know if they actually survived once they fleed the island or not?
